Groceries - Pen Centre - St. Catharines, Ontario
Home
US Malls
Canadian Malls
Home
>
Canada
>
Ontario
>
St. Catharines
>
Pen Centre
>
Groceries
Groceries
List of Groceries in Pen Centre (St. Catharines, ON).
Buck Or Two
Zehrs